What is the wavelength of radiation that has a frequency of 6.912 × 10^15 s–1?

Answer:

Wavelength = 4.34x10⁻⁸m

Step-by-step explanation:

In a wave, frequency is inversely proportional to wavelength where the constant is the speed of light. The equation is:

Wavelength = Speed of light / Frequency

The speed of light is 3.0x10⁸m/s

Replacing:

Wavelength = 3.0x10⁸m/s / 6.912x10¹⁵s⁻¹

Wavelength = 4.34x10⁻⁸m
